  • What is a healthcare and social services assistant?

    A healthcare and social services assistant is a professional who provides support and assistance to individuals in need of healthcare and social services. They may work in a variety of settings, such as hospitals, nursing homes, or community organizations, and their responsibilities can include helping with daily activities, providing emotional support, and assisting with medical procedures. These professionals play a crucial role in ensuring that individuals receive the care and support they need to improve their overall well-being.

  • What is a healthcare worker?

    A healthcare worker is an individual who provides medical care and support to patients in various healthcare settings such as hospitals, clinics, and nursing homes. They can include doctors, nurses, pharmacists, therapists, and other professionals who work together to diagnose, treat, and prevent illnesses and injuries. Healthcare workers play a crucial role in promoting the well-being and health of individuals and communities by delivering quality and compassionate care.

  • What is a healthcare merchant?

    A healthcare merchant is a business or individual that sells goods or services related to the healthcare industry. This can include medical equipment suppliers, pharmaceutical companies, healthcare technology providers, and other businesses that cater to the needs of healthcare facilities and professionals. Healthcare merchants play a crucial role in providing the necessary products and services to support the delivery of healthcare to patients. They may operate as wholesalers, distributors, or retailers, and often have to adhere to specific regulations and standards within the healthcare industry.
